The Accounts Payable Analyst provides analytical and operational support as a member of the Accounts Payable (AP) team, ensuring accurate, timely, and compliant execution of AP processes for assigned India ABO entities. The role focuses on delivering high-quality financial reporting, driving process standardization and automation, strengthening internal controls, and enhancing customer experience through proactive stakeholder engagement and business partnering.
Key Responsibilities Operational Excellence & Month-End Close- Complete all month-end close activities accurately and on time (by WD 3), ensuring “right-first-time” delivery.
- Prepare and submit CMI and IGAAP reconciliations for assigned Business Units accurately and within timelines.
- Prepare audit schedules including Trade Payables, AP Debit Balances, MSME, and AP Sub-Ledger Variance.
- Prepare AP Packs for Balance Sheet reviews.
- Perform SOx and/or IFC controls for the AP function, maintain supporting documentation, and ensure timely corporate submissions.
- Provide timely support during audits, reviews, and control testing for assigned Business Centers.
- Prepare, analyze, and review AP ageing reports; drive resolution of aged and outstanding items.
- Prepare analyses, statistical reports, and insights for the Accounts Payable team.
- Interpret financial data by analyzing trends, variances, risks, and opportunities.
- Provide recommendations for improvements in processes and controls.
- Ensure integrity of financial data by investigating discrepancies and implementing corrective actions.
- Identify opportunities for standardization across AP workstreams while respecting unique Business Unit requirements.
- Explore automation opportunities to improve efficiency and reduce manual interventions.
- Prepare, maintain, and revise Standard Operating Procedures (SOPs) as required.
- Participate in and execute special projects and continuous improvement initiatives.
- Foster strong partnerships with Business Units and cross-functional Finance teams.
- Arrange and lead review meetings with stakeholders to enhance business effectiveness.
- Document meeting minutes (MOM), track action items, and ensure timely closure.
- Address escalations and critical cases with urgency; proactively elevate risks to avoid service disruptions.
- Serve as a trusted advisor to stakeholders, driving a customer-focused culture and enhancing overall service delivery experience.

Qualifications
- College, university, or equivalent degree in Accounting, Finance, or related field required.
- Professional certifications (e.g., CA Inter, CMA Inter, CPA – preferred but not mandatory).
- Understanding of Indian GAAP (IGAAP) and internal financial controls preferred.

Functional Competencies
- Business Partnering – Collaborates with stakeholders to align financial processes with business strategy; provides financial insights to support decision-making.
- Financial Analysis – Analyzes financial results, identifies trends and variances, and communicates insights to stakeholders.
- Strong knowledge of Accounts Payable processes and controls.
- Working knowledge of SOx/IFC controls and audit requirements.
- Strong analytical and problem-solving skills.
- Proficiency in MS Excel and ERP systems (SAP or similar preferred).
- Basic understanding of automation tools and process improvement methodologies.
Experience
- Minimal relevant work experience required.
- Experience in Accounts Payable, financial reporting, reconciliations, or shared services environment preferred.
- Exposure to month-end close, audits, and internal controls is an advantage.
